A programmable array processor architecture for flexible approximate string matching algorithms

This paper proposes a generic programmable array processor architecture for a wide variety of approximate string matching algorithms. Further, we describe the architecture of the array and the architecture of the cell in detail in order to efficiently implement for both the preprocessing and searchi...

Full description

Saved in:
Bibliographic Details
Published in:2005 International Conference on Parallel Processing Workshops (ICPPW'05) pp. 201 - 209
Main Authors: Michailidis, P.D., Margaritis, K.G.
Format: Conference Proceeding
Language:English
Published: IEEE 2005
Subjects:
ISBN:9780769523811, 0769523811
ISSN:0190-3918
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
Description
Summary:This paper proposes a generic programmable array processor architecture for a wide variety of approximate string matching algorithms. Further, we describe the architecture of the array and the architecture of the cell in detail in order to efficiently implement for both the preprocessing and searching phases of most string matching algorithms. Further, the architecture performs approximate string matching for complex patterns that contain don't care, complement and classes symbols. Our architecture maximizes the strength of VLSI in terms of intensive and pipelined computing and yet circumvents the limitation on communication. It may be adopted as a basic structure for a universal flexible string matcher engine.
ISBN:9780769523811
0769523811
ISSN:0190-3918
DOI:10.1109/ICPPW.2005.15